What does MVP development mean? The method of creating a minimum viable product (MVP) is to make a simpler version of a mobile app with just the most important elements. The idea is to launch quickly, get input from real users, and make the product better based on what the market really requires. MVP is different from full-scale Mobile Application Development since it focuses on learning first and constructing second. This saves time, money, and resources. Important Steps in Creating an MVP Checking the Idea and Doing Market Research: Before you start building, you check to see if your idea is viable by looking at what your competitors are doing, talking to users, and finding problems. This makes sure that your program really does fix a problem. Prioritizing Features: We only choose key features, which are the ones that give users direct value. This method keeps Mobile App Development on track and productive. Designing the UX/UI for an MVP: A basic, easy-to-use design is made to make sure that users have a satisfying experience without making the interface too complicated. Agile Testing and Development: Developers employ agile methods to construct the MVP gradually, scrutinizing its features and performance at every stage.
